That Corsa looks nice and aggressive on the outside, but I really don't like the plastic interior, hardly any room either.
I think as MR2 owners we have to face facts, some of these modern supermini's are actually good rapid little cars. It's the result of all the latest technology and engineering. TDI's are also getting faster whilst still returning very good mpg figures.
The rev 3 turbo should beat most other cars but I must admit some supermini's have really surprised me with their speed. The thing is they can pretty much floor it in all weathers but we have to be careful being RWD and mid-engined.
